Rating films with smoking 'R' will cut smoking onset by teens, experts say

Monday, July 9, 2012 - 16:00 in Health & Medicine

New research estimates, for the first time, the impact of an R rating for movie smoking. Researchers emphasize that an R rating for any film showing smoking could substantially reduce smoking onset in US adolescents -- an effect size similar to making all parents maximally authoritative in their parenting, they say.
